Linux系统的基本命令教程:新手该从哪些命令开始学习

时间:2025-12-08 分类:操作系统

Linux系统是一款广受欢迎的开源操作系统,其命令行界面为用户提供了强大的控制能力。对于新手来说,掌握一些基本命令是进入Linux世界的重要一步。这篇文章将着重介绍新手用户应该先学习的基本命令,并为他们提供实用的操作技巧和示例。

Linux系统的基本命令教程:新手该从哪些命令开始学习

在Linux中,命令行被广泛使用,是进行系统管理和日常操作的重要工具。新手在学习过程中,应该从以下几个基础命令开始入手:

1. ls

这是最常用的命令之一,显示当前目录下的文件和文件夹。使用`ls -l`可以查看文件的详细信息,包括权限、文件大小和修改时间。结合`ls -a`命令,可以显示隐藏文件。通过这些选项,用户能更好地了解目录结构。

2. cd

改变目录的命令。使用`cd`加上目录名称,可以快速切换到指定文件夹。例如,`cd Documents`可以进入Documents文件夹。想要返回上一级目录,可以使用`cd ..`命令。

3. cp

用于复制文件或文件夹。命令格式为`cp 源文件 目标文件`。学习使用`cp -r`选项可以更容易地复制整个目录。这对文件管理特别有帮助。

4. mv

通过该命令,用户能够移动或重命名文件。命令的基本用法是`mv 原文件 新文件`,对于文件分类和整理很有用。

5. rm

删除文件或目录的命令。需要小心使用,因为一旦删除,文件无法恢复。使用`rm -r`可以删除一个目录及其所有内容。他人类型的删除命令可能导致数据丢失,因此务必在删除之前确认文件重要性。

6. touch

可以创建空文件或更新现有文件的时间戳。这是一个简单却非常实用的命令,特别是在进行脚本编写时。

7. mkdir

创建新目录的命令。这对组织文件系统至关重要。`mkdir 新目录`命令帮助用户快速搭建文件夹结构。

8. man

帮助命令(manual)用于查看命令的帮助文档,非常适合新手查找命令使用的详细说明。命令格式是`man 命令名称`,例如,`man cp`会显示cp命令的使用方法及选项。

9. pwd

这个命令用来显示当前工作目录。当需要确认位置时非常实用。

10. grep

用于搜索文本文件中的特定内容。这个命令在处理日志文件和数据时极其方便。

掌握这些基本命令后,新手用户可以更舒适地在Linux环境中导航和操作。了解一些基本的命令行技巧会让用户在日常使用中更高效,比如使用Tab键自动补全命令与文件名。

常见问题解答

1. 什么是Linux命令行?

Linux命令行是一种通过输入指令来与操作系统交互的方式。它能够让用户在没有图形界面的情况下进行系统管理。

2. 新手学习Linux需要多久?

学习的时间因人而异,通常在几周到几个月不等,具体取决于个人的学习投入和实践频率。

3. 如何提高Linux命令行的使用效率?

多练习是提高效率的关键。了解和使用常用的快捷键、命令别名以及编写脚本都可以帮助提升操作效率。

4. 是否需要额外的软件来运行Linux?

不需要,Linux系统可以直接安装在硬盘上,也可以使用虚拟机进行安装和测试。你还可以使用USB驱动制作启动盘来体验Linux。

5. 如何获取Linux的帮助文档?

大多数Linux系统都自带man手册。输入`man 命令名`就可以查看相关帮助信息。在线社区和论坛也是避免新手问题的重要资源。